新聞中心
VC 執(zhí)行cl.exe出錯(cuò)如何解決

成都創(chuàng)新互聯(lián)服務(wù)項(xiàng)目包括萬(wàn)源網(wǎng)站建設(shè)、萬(wàn)源網(wǎng)站制作、萬(wàn)源網(wǎng)頁(yè)制作以及萬(wàn)源網(wǎng)絡(luò)營(yíng)銷(xiāo)策劃等。多年來(lái),我們專(zhuān)注于互聯(lián)網(wǎng)行業(yè),利用自身積累的技術(shù)優(yōu)勢(shì)、行業(yè)經(jīng)驗(yàn)、深度合作伙伴關(guān)系等,向廣大中小型企業(yè)、政府機(jī)構(gòu)等提供互聯(lián)網(wǎng)行業(yè)的解決方案,萬(wàn)源網(wǎng)站推廣取得了明顯的社會(huì)效益與經(jīng)濟(jì)效益。目前,我們服務(wù)的客戶(hù)以成都為中心已經(jīng)輻射到萬(wàn)源省份的部分城市,未來(lái)相信會(huì)繼續(xù)擴(kuò)大服務(wù)區(qū)域并繼續(xù)獲得客戶(hù)的支持與信任!
在Visual Studio中,我們經(jīng)常使用CL編譯器來(lái)編譯C/C++程序,在使用過(guò)程中,可能會(huì)遇到執(zhí)行cl.exe出錯(cuò)的問(wèn)題,本文將介紹如何解決這個(gè)問(wèn)題,并提供一些建議和相關(guān)問(wèn)題的解答。
檢查CL編譯器的路徑設(shè)置
1、打開(kāi)Visual Studio,點(diǎn)擊菜單欄的“工具”>“選項(xiàng)”。
2、在“選項(xiàng)”窗口中,展開(kāi)“項(xiàng)目和解決方案”>“VC++目錄”。
3、檢查“包含文件(包含)”和“庫(kù)文件(庫(kù))”的路徑是否正確,如果不正確,請(qǐng)修改為正確的路徑。
4、確?!案郊影夸洝敝邪诵枰念^文件路徑。
5、點(diǎn)擊“確定”保存設(shè)置。
檢查命令行參數(shù)是否正確
1、在Visual Studio中,右鍵點(diǎn)擊項(xiàng)目名稱(chēng),選擇“屬性”。
2、在“屬性”窗口中,選擇“配置屬性”>“鏈接器”>“命令行”。
3、在“命令行”文本框中,檢查是否有錯(cuò)誤的參數(shù)或語(yǔ)法錯(cuò)誤,檢查是否有多余的空格、缺少分號(hào)等。
4、如果有錯(cuò)誤,請(qǐng)修正后點(diǎn)擊“確定”保存設(shè)置。
檢查環(huán)境變量設(shè)置
1、按下Win+R鍵,輸入“sysdm.cpl”,按回車(chē)鍵打開(kāi)系統(tǒng)屬性窗口。
2、在“系統(tǒng)屬性”窗口中,選擇“高級(jí)”選項(xiàng)卡,然后點(diǎn)擊“環(huán)境變量”按鈕。
3、在“環(huán)境變量”窗口中,檢查以下兩個(gè)環(huán)境變量是否設(shè)置正確:
PATH:確保其中包含了CL編譯器的路徑,“C:Program Files (x86)Microsoft Visual Studio2019CommunityVCToolsMSVC14.28.29910binHostx64x64”;
INCLUDE:確保其中包含了需要的頭文件路徑,“C:Program Files (x86)Microsoft Visual Studio2019CommunityVCToolsMSVC14.28.29910include;%INCLUDE%”。
4、如果有錯(cuò)誤,請(qǐng)修正后點(diǎn)擊“確定”保存設(shè)置。
重啟Visual Studio
1、關(guān)閉Visual Studio。
2、重新打開(kāi)Visual Studio,然后嘗試重新編譯項(xiàng)目。
3、如果問(wèn)題仍然存在,可以嘗試重啟計(jì)算機(jī)后再次編譯項(xiàng)目。
其他建議和解答
1、確保已經(jīng)安裝了正確版本的Visual Studio和CL編譯器;
2、檢查項(xiàng)目中的代碼是否有語(yǔ)法錯(cuò)誤或邏輯錯(cuò)誤;
3、如果使用的是第三方庫(kù),請(qǐng)確保已經(jīng)正確安裝了相應(yīng)的運(yùn)行時(shí)環(huán)境;
4、如果問(wèn)題依然無(wú)法解決,可以查閱相關(guān)文檔或在開(kāi)發(fā)者社區(qū)尋求幫助。
相關(guān)問(wèn)題與解答:
Q1:為什么我的CL編譯器無(wú)法找到標(biāo)準(zhǔn)庫(kù)文件?
A1:可能是因?yàn)闃?biāo)準(zhǔn)庫(kù)文件的路徑?jīng)]有添加到系統(tǒng)的PATH環(huán)境變量中,請(qǐng)按照本文的方法檢查并修改環(huán)境變量設(shè)置。
Q2:我修改了CL編譯器的路徑設(shè)置,但是沒(méi)有生效怎么辦?
A2:請(qǐng)確保在Visual Studio的“選項(xiàng)”窗口中正確設(shè)置了CL編譯器的路徑,檢查項(xiàng)目的屬性設(shè)置是否也使用了相同的路徑。
Q3:我在命令行中使用了正確的參數(shù)和語(yǔ)法,但是仍然出現(xiàn)錯(cuò)誤怎么辦?
A3:請(qǐng)嘗試重啟Visual Studio或計(jì)算機(jī)后再次編譯項(xiàng)目,一些臨時(shí)文件可能導(dǎo)致問(wèn)題,重啟可以清除這些文件。
當(dāng)前題目:VC執(zhí)行cl.exe出錯(cuò)如何解決
分享網(wǎng)址:http://www.5511xx.com/article/dpsioeo.html


咨詢(xún)
建站咨詢(xún)
